.button {
	color: #900;
	cursor: pointer;
	display: block;
	font-size: 13px;
	font-weight: 700;
}

.button .left {
	background-image: url(/images/buttonElements/knap_l.gif);
	background-repeat: no-repeat;
	height: 23px;
	width: 4px;
}

.button .middle {
	background-image: url(/images/buttonElements/knap_b.gif);
	background-repeat: repeat-x;
	height: 23px;
}

.button .right {
	background-image: url(/images/buttonElements/knap_r.gif);
	background-repeat: no-repeat;
	height: 23px;
	width: 4px;
}

.button .text {
	padding-left: 10px;
	padding-right: 10px;
	vertical-align: middle;
}


.buttonGreen .left {
	background-image: url(/images/buttonElements/knap_gl.gif);
	background-repeat: no-repeat;
	height: 23px;
	width: 4px;
}

.buttonGreen .middle {
	background-image: url(/images/buttonElements/knap_gb.gif);
	background-repeat: repeat-x;
	height: 23px;
}

.buttonGreen .right {
	background-image: url(/images/buttonElements/knap_gr.gif);
	background-repeat: no-repeat;
	height: 23px;
	width: 4px;
}

.buttonGreen .text {
	padding-left: 10px;
	padding-right: 10px;
	vertical-align: middle;
}

.buttonGreen, .buttonLarge {
	color: #fff;
	cursor: pointer;
	display: block;
	font-family: "trebuchet ms";
	font-size: 13px;
	font-weight: 700;
}

.buttonLarge .left {
	background-image: url(/images/buttonElements/knap_sl.gif);
	background-repeat: no-repeat;
	height: 40px;
	width: 4px;
}

.buttonLarge .middle {
	background-image: url(/images/buttonElements/knap_sb.gif);
	background-repeat: repeat-x;
	height: 40px;
}

.buttonLarge .right {
	background-image: url(/images/buttonElements/knap_sr.gif);
	background-repeat: no-repeat;
	height: 40px;
	width: 4px;
}

.buttonLarge .text {
	padding-left: 10px;
	padding-right: 10px;
	vertical-align: middle;
}
